Year 6 Class Teacher job summary

The Role

Year 6 Class Teacher

for

St Chad’s Catholic Primary School

Catholic Lane, Sedgley, DY3 3UE

Closing Date: Tuesday 24 February at 12 noon

Interviews: Week commencing 2 March 2026

Salary:MPS 3- UPS3

We are seeking an experienced and motivated Year 6 Teacher to join our dedicated team. This is a key role within the school, requiring a practitioner with strong classroom practice, high expectations and a proven ability to prepare pupils for end-of-key-stage assessments and transition to secondary school.

The Successful Candidate Will:
  • Be an experienced Key Stage 2 teacher, ideally with recent Year 6 experience

  • Have a strong understanding of the Year 6 curriculum and assessment requirements (including SATs)

  • Demonstrate excellent classroom management and high standards of teaching and learning

  • Be committed to inclusive practice and meeting the needs of all learners

  • Support and promote the Catholic ethos of the school (practising Catholics are encouraged to apply, but this is not essential)

  • Work effectively as part of a collaborative and supportive staff team

St Chad’s Catholic Primary Schools (Dudley) is:

Voluntary Catholic Academy that is part of the St John Bosco Catholic Academy together with, St Joseph’s Catholic Primary School, Sedgley, Bishop Milner Catholic College in Dudley, St Mary’s Catholic Primary School Wednesbury, St Bernadette’s Walsall and Stuart Bathurst Catholic Secondary School Wednesbury.

-The school is popular and over-subscribed and has a friendly and caring atmosphere.
-The school is a one form entry Catholic school with Nursery.
-St Chad’s provides a happy and safe environment where everyone, children and adults alike, is given the chance to flourish.
